Wonju City Appoints Chef Lee Yeonbok as Ambassador for 'Wonju Dumpling Festival'

Wonju City Holds Final Briefing for 2025 Wonju Dumpling Festival
A High-Quality Festival Promised for Citizens and Visitors

Wonju City, Gangwon Province, held a ceremony on the 15th to appoint Chef Lee Yeonbok as an ambassador and followed it with the final briefing session for the '2025 Wonju Dumpling Festival,' which will be held for three days from October 24 to 26.

The ambassador appointment ceremony, held at the investment consultation room on the 7th floor of Wonju City Hall, was attended by Mayor Won Kangsoo, Park Changho, CEO of the Wonju Cultural Foundation, Chef Lee Yeonbok, and festival officials.


Chef Lee Yeonbok is a renowned master of Chinese cuisine in Korea, widely loved by the public for his popularity and approachable image. Through this appointment, he will participate in various promotional activities for the Wonju Dumpling Festival and contribute to enhancing the city brand value of Wonju through dumplings.


Subsequently, at 4:20 p.m., the '2025 Wonju Dumpling Festival Final Briefing Session' was held at the Namsangol Cultural Center, where the preparation process was reviewed and the overall operational plans-including program composition, transportation and safety management, and promotional strategies-were finalized.


In addition, members of the organizing committee, Wonju City officials, and representatives from the Wonju Cultural Foundation will thoroughly review the festival's overall safety management system, traffic control plans, and on-site staff deployment.


Furthermore, a total of 32 food booths selected through previous booth recruitment and showcases, as well as citizen participation programs, have been finalized. The festival will feature a variety of programs for all ages, including dumpling cooking classes, live cooking shows, local art performances, and a cultural arts experience zone.


Mayor Won Kangsoo stated, "With Chef Lee Yeonbok joining, the Wonju Dumpling Festival will become even more vibrant and attract greater attention. As we have thoroughly reviewed all the preparations at today's final briefing, we will present a festival that will satisfy both citizens and visitors."
